I agree with crashkerry...If you think about a 2 1/2 yr old dog already pregnant with her fourth litter, then for myself that would be enough to turn me away. You can't even get hips and elbows certified till 18 months...so this means he bred her long before she was even checked. I think you'd be wise to check out other breeders.
